## Runbook: Lexibridge string extraction

Before running the extraction script, confirm you are on the latest main branch of the Lexibridge repo and that your locale config matches the staging manifest. The script walks every template under the Quillpane UI tree, pulls translatable strings, and writes them to the handoff bundle for the Varnholt localization team. Once extraction completes cleanly, record the token printed on the final line below.

build token for kagaf-hahof: htk14_9d3d4d26d7d8de

## Configuration

Plugin authors integrating with Larkspan Gateway should be aware of a session-token refresh bug in versions prior to 4.2.1: tokens refreshed within 30 seconds of expiry could be silently dropped, invalidating the plugin's session mid-request. The fix requires the refresh signing secret to be present at boot rather than lazily loaded. Verify your sandbox env file includes it before testing refresh flows. Add the following line to your plugin's .env now:

env line for yahip-tafog: RELAY_SECRET3=4ca

If your plugin writes a rate override, you must call the invalidation hook immediately; otherwise checkout flows may apply stale rates until the TTL expires. Never bypass RateVault by querying the rates table directly — reads are not guaranteed consistent during a refresh cycle. Batch invalidations are throttled to 50 keys per minute per plugin. The complete invalidation API reference, including retry semantics and error codes, lives at the internal page below.

wiki page, faduf-tagaf: https://superset.halixdata.example/build